Vicious Walkers and Random Contraction Matrices

Abstract: The ensemble CUE(q) of truncated random unitary matrices is a deformation of the usual Circular Unitary Ensemble depending on a discrete non-negative parameter q. CUE(q) is an exactly solved model of random contraction matrices originally introduced in the context of scattering theory. In this article, we exhibit a connection between CUE(q) and Fisher's random-turns vicious walker model from statistical mechanics. In particular, we show that the moment generating function of the trace of a random matrix from CUE(q) is a generating series for the partition function of Fisher's model, when the walkers are assumed to represent mutually attracting particles.
